Question
3(5-12)+4 divided by 2

To solve the expression 3(5-12)+4 divided by 2, we need to follow the order of operations, which is parentheses, exponents, multiplication/division (from left to right), and addition/subtraction (from left to right).
First, simplify the expression inside the parentheses:
5 - 12 = -7
Now rewrite the expression with the simplified value:
3(-7) + 4 divided by 2
Next, perform the multiplication:
3 * -7 = -21
Now perform the division:
4 divided by 2 = 2
Finally, add the results of the previous steps:
-21 + 2 = -19
Therefore, 3(5-12)+4 divided by 2 equals -19.
